Getting ready for a date

She sat in her closet staring at the vast racks of clothes which seemingly had nothing wearable on them. Why don't I ever get anything cute when I shop?, she thought. Finally, she decided on a pink v-neck, her cutest dark-wash jeans with a swirl of rhinestones on each back pocket, and black gladiator sandals. To accompany this outfit, she added a long silver necklace and a black clutch. She moved down the hall, barely capable of walking. The butterflies in her stomach seemed to alter her balance drastically. In the bathroom, she decided to straighten her hair. She plugged in the flat iron and let it heat up. As she waited for the red light signaling heat to appear, she brushed her teeth for the minty fresh breathe effect. She grabbed a tube of mascara and applied it to her perfect lashes after completing the rest of her make-up. As a nice finishing touch, she carefully smoothed shiny pink lip gloss onto her lips. Out of the corner of her eye, she saw the small, red light illuminate. She proceeded to straighten her hair until it was flawless and as straight and shiny as glass.
